Its been a busy week for the Golden State Warriors, who keep on adding talent to a team that won 73 games a season ago.

A day after signing Kevin Durant, the Warriors brought in power forward David West according to ESPN. West, who will turn 36 before the season starts, will be under contract for one season and will make the leagues veteran minimum salary of $543,471.

The veteran was drafted 18th overall in 2003 by the New Orleans Hornets and spent the next eight seasons with the franchise before turning in four solid years with the Indiana Pacers. Last season, West took a pay cut to sign with the San Antonio Spurs in hopes of winning a title and will do the same with Golden State in 2016.

Wests best stretch came with New Orleans in 2007 and 2008, when he averaged over 20 points per game in both seasons and was named to back-to-back All-Star teams. While West has slowed down considerably with age, he was still a solid bench player in San Antonio last year, averaging seven points and four rebounds in 18 minutes per contest according to Basketball-Reference.

[Photo by Jason Miller/Getty ImagesOverall, West has averaged 14.8 points and 6.9 rebounds per game while shooting just shy of 50 percent of the field for his career, good for a lifetime PER of 18.6.

Durant is clearly the best addition of the NBA free agency period so far and makes the Warriors look like a juggernaut on paper, but Golden State has also done a great job of adding some depth to fill out the bench. The Warriors added Zaza Pachulia, a completely serviceable big man, for just $2.9 million on Monday.

Adding depth is going to be a critical part of Golden States offseason plan, as the team lost role players like Harrison Barnes, Festus Ezeli, and Andrew Bogut from the record-breaking 73-win squad. Durant, Steph Curry, Draymond Green, and Klay Thompson will carry the load as the most formidable team the NBA has seen on paper in quite some time, the bench will also play an important role in helping the Warriors reach their ultimate goal of a title.

Signing West could prove to be particularly important, as the Warriors could be a little strapped for frontcourt depth next season. In addition to Ezeli and Bogut leaving, Golden State may not be able to re-sign big men Marreese Speights and Anderson Varejao.

West figures to split minutes with second-year player Kevon Looney as the backup power forward behind Green. Even in his mid-30s, West played a role in San Antonios 67-win season last year and should provide some instant offense off the bench with his strong mid-range jumper.

Small moves like adding West can make a meaningful difference for a team looking to break a wins record or make a deep postseason run. Bringing in Durant gives the Warriors an incredible starting lineup, but sometimes, it can take more than that to win an NBA championship as LeBron James and the Miami Heat found out in 2010.

[Photo by Ezra Shaw/Getty Images]Fans and even other players around the league have voiced their displeasure at Durants decision to join Golden State, accusing him of being a ring chaser, and West is certainly guilty of the same crime. West opted out of his contract in Indiana last offseason and took an $11 million pay cut to head to San Antonio and could have got more on the open market this year than the veteran minimum.

The Warriors may not be done adding veteran pieces who want a title for cheap, as the team still has more depth to fill out. As it stands now, Golden State is the clear title favorite heading into next year, with moves like adding West making a small yet meaningful difference.

With Timofey Mozgov now playing for the Los Angeles Lakers, the Cleveland Cavaliers are looking for big men to help fill out their roster. One target theyve contacted: veteran forward David West.

West, who played for the Indiana Pacers before taking a massive pay cut to play for the San Antonio Spurs last summer, has yet to decide if h**l play next season per Chris Haynes of cleveland.com. Per Haynes, a number of teams are interested in West and there is no timetable for his decision.

Considering that the Spurs just added Pau Gasol, the Cavs might be an attractive option for West. In Cleveland, he could come off the bench and chase a title with the favorite to represent the Eastern Conference in the NBA Finals. That said, Tim Duncan may retire and the Spurs may also have to let Boris Diaw go in order to sign Gasol. They might need to bring West back.

If he can be signed, West would be a solid veteran addition to the Cavs. Hes not a rim protector, but hes still a solid post player and rebounder at age 35. Cleveland could do a lot worse considering their limited assets.

West averaged 7.1 points and four rebounds per game last season in San Antonio.
